  • Abstract
    A new method based on the attraction of ferromagnetic materials has been developed to increase the amount of co-electrodeposited second-phase particles in composite coatings. For this, ZrO2 particles were coated with electroless nickel coating which is used as a magnetic shell. The application of a magnetic field in co-electrodeposition of these particles in Ni deposit increases the amount of incorporated particles. Attraction between ferromagnetic electroplated Ni coating and magnetized particles was recognized as the reason for this higher incorporation.
